The Core Function: Bridging the Gap
This adapter's fundamental purpose is to convert a 1/4-inch hex shank output, common on impact drivers and many cordless screwdrivers, into a three-jaw chuck capable of holding round-shank drill bits. The visual evidence clearly shows a hexagonal base designed to slot directly into a standard 1/4-inch quick-change chuck, while the opposing end features a keyless three-jaw mechanism. This allows for immediate integration with a vast array of power
tools already present in most workshops.
For users who frequently switch between driving screws and drilling pilot holes, this conversion capability streamlines workflow. It eliminates the need to swap between an impact driver and a dedicated drill for minor drilling tasks, saving considerable time on job sites or during home improvement projects. Engineering for Grip and Precision
The keyless chuck mechanism, visible in both the silver/black and all-black variants, features a knurled surface for manual tightening. This design enables users to secure drill bits without the need for a separate chuck key, which can often be misplaced or add unnecessary bulk to a toolbox. The three-jaw configuration is standard for drill chucks, providing a balanced and firm grip on the bit shank.
Secure bit retention is paramount for drilling precision and user safety. A poorly secured bit can wobble, leading to inaccurate holes, damaged workpieces, or even dangerous bit ejection. The robust appearance of the chuck body, particularly the metal components, suggests a mechanism built to withstand the rotational forces and vibrations inherent in drilling operations. Bits stay put.
Unlike lower-quality adapters that might rely on friction alone or have less precise jaw alignment, this keyless design aims for consistent clamping pressure. This ensures that even small-diameter bits, within the specified 0.012-0.142 inch (0.3-3.6mm) range, are held firmly. This precision minimizes bit runout, which is critical for clean, accurate holes in materials like wood, plastic, or soft metals.

Heat Management and Bit Longevity
While this is a chuck and not a cutting tool, its ability to securely hold a bit directly impacts heat management at the bit-workpiece interface. A wobbly or slipping bit generates excessive friction and heat, leading to premature bit dulling or breakage. A firm grip from the chuck ensures that the bit rotates true, allowing for efficient material removal and less heat buildup.
